b. 13 Jan 1918, d. 22 Aug 1998. Richard Henry Anderson was born in Storden Twp., Cottonwood County, MN to Henry and Randa (Engebretson) Anderson. He received his education in Storden and graduated from high school in 1936.

He entered the Army Air Corps on 13 Jan 1942 and served in England in 1942 and in Egypt in 1945.

He married Estelle Jones in 1944. They had 3 children.  After his honorable discharge, the couple farmed near Storden until retiring in 1985.  For 23 years he was a Pioneer Seed dealer. He was a member of the Storden VFW and American Legion and served on the Storden School Board and Storden Elevator Board.

Buried in the Bethany Lutheran Cemetery in Storden, MN.
